Subject: Partner SFTP drop — new owner

Hi,

As you review the pending changes to the Harborline ingest scripts, note that ownership of the partner SFTP drop is changing at the end of the month. This includes key rotation, the nightly pull job, and the quarantine folder for malformed files. Review comments on the retry logic should still go through the normal PR flow, but questions about drop-folder conventions or partner onboarding now go to the new owner. The incoming owner is listed below.

signatory, tagaf-bahaf: Praael Fenmir Rusok

**Deep-link routing — Skylark plugin basics**

All plugin deep links route through the Skylark dispatcher. Register your URI patterns at install time; runtime registration is ignored. Patterns must be unique per plugin — collisions fail silently in production, loudly in sandbox. Universal links require an entry in the shared manifest, reviewed weekly. Pattern syntax, manifest format, and submission steps are documented here.

wiki page, tahaf-tajog: https://jira.ordindyn.corp/pipeline

Ticket #982 — Sealed vault blocking compaction review

Reviewer: the log compaction changes for the Thrushline queue reduce segment retention from 14 to 7 days, with tombstone cleanup every hour. Benchmarks are stored in the Ironbarrel vault, which locked after the cert rotation. The recovery passphrase to reopen it is below.

unlock words, hahip-baduf: holwyn-istath-julvan

Ticket: PUB-3307 — Incremental rebuild rollout

Support team heads-up: Lanternleaf Docs is switching from full site rebuilds to incremental rebuilds via the Quillstack pipeline. Expect page updates to appear within two minutes instead of twenty. If a customer reports stale pages, check the rebuild ledger before escalating. The change ships behind a tenant flag and needs sign-off before wider rollout. Approval is pending from the person named below.

account owner for kafop-haweg: Pelax Gilael Istir